How much do weekend western modeling j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for weekend western modeling in the United States is $101,255.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$78,500.00 and $129,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How to get into weekend western modeling?

To get into weekend western modeling, build a portfolio showcasing western attire and rodeo or country-themed photos, and gain experience through local events or photoshoots. Networking with industry professionals and maintaining a professional online presence can also help attract opportunities. Relevant skills include posing, understanding western fashion, and familiarity with modeling standards.

Job description

This position is eligible for hiring incentives to include sign-on bonus and relocation assistance.

Summary

Add variety to your practice while meeting the emergency medical needs of Western Minnesota.  Provide Emergency Medicine care through varying shifts, rotating weekends, and holidays in Long Prairie, Melrose, Paynesville, and Sauk Centre, MN. This is a full-time employed position requiring roughly 10-12 shifts a month.

Schedule

Location: CentraCare-Long Prairie
Typical Shift: 12- and 24-hour shifts (12-hour shifts are 8a-8p or 8p-8a)

Location: CentraCare-Melrose
Typical Shift: Mon-Thu 4p-8a, Fri-Sun 8a-8p or 8p-8a

Location: CentraCare-Paynesville
Typical Shift: 12- and 24-hour shifts (12-hour shifts are 8a-8p or 8p-8a)
Location: CentraCare-Sauk Centre
Typical Shift: Mon-Thu a combination of 8a-8p or 8p-8a, or 4p-8a Friday-Sunday 8a-8p, 8p-8a

Pay and Benefits

  • Salary range: $300,000 - $325,000 per year

    • Pay may be determined by factors such as education, experience, skills, knowledge, location, and internal equity

    • Salary and salary range are based on a 1.0 FTE, reduced FTE will result in a prorated offer rate

    • May be eligible for additional pay through bonuses, quality incentives, or production-based (RVU) compensation.

  • Benefits: Medical, dental, time off, retirement, employee discounts and more!

Qualifications

Required:

  • Must be BE/BC and able to obtain a MN License. FM and EM are both eligible.

  • ED Shift required ACLS and a trauma certification such as CALS or ATLS unless otherwise specified. 

Our Location

CentraCare, a leading not-for-profit health system and one of the largest providers of rural care, serves patients across Central, West Central, and Southwestern Minnesota. It delivers nationally recognized care through 40+ medical and surgical specialties, innovative population health programs, and a collaborative physician–administration leadership model. CentraCare’s Long Prairie, Melrose, and Sauk Centre locations are Level IV trauma centers and critical access hospitals with family medicine clinics, advanced imaging, and comprehensive outpatient services. Each serves a welcoming, family-friendly community surrounded by parks, lakes, and abundant recreational opportunities.
